A GROUP OF THREE RARE PAINTED GREY POTTERY WINE VESSELS
Han dynasty (206 BC-AD 220)
Each with cylindrical body curving inwards towards the slightly concave base and painted with a wide band of white dots between white line borders, all below the canted shoulder rising to a constricted neck and widely flared mouth pinched closely together from two sides to create a narrow opening curving downwards to create a spout at either end and covered with a white slip
7¾in. (19.7cm.) high (3)
